Overview Looptor 20 Tablet
Aquaflow 20mg tablets are classified as diuretics, commonly known as water pills. They alleviate swelling (edema) resulting from fluid retention in patients with heart, liver, or kidney conditions. This medication also manages hypertension. Aquaflow 20mg facilitates the elimination of excess water and sodium via urine. It can be administered alone or alongside other medications, as directed by your physician. Consumption may be with or without food, consistently at the same time daily. To minimize nighttime urination, avoid dosing within four hours of sleep. Continued use is crucial, even with symptom improvement; premature discontinuation may exacerbate your condition. Adopting a healthier lifestyle—stress reduction, dietary sodium restriction, and smoking cessation—can enhance treatment efficacy. Common, typically transient, side effects include headache, lightheadedness, dehydration, lowered blood pressure, and indigestion. Persistent or bothersome effects warrant medical consultation.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or of any liver ailments. Pregnant or lactating individuals should seek medical advice before use. Regular monitoring of kidney function and electrolyte levels is essential. As this medication might lower potassium levels, your doctor may recommend increased potassium-rich foods (bananas, coconut water, etc.) or supplementation.

How Looptor 20 Tablet works:
Aquasol 20mg tablets function as a diuretic, eliminating excess fluid and specific electrolytes through enhanced urinary output.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Alcohol consumption alongside Looptor 20 Tablet lacks established safety data. Physician consultation is advised.
Preg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
The use of Looptor 20 Tablet during pregnancy is typically deemed safe. Preclinical trials in animals revealed minimal or no negative consequences for fetal development; nonetheless, data from human trials are scarce.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Use of Looptor 20 Tablet while breastfeeding is likely safe. Available human data indicates minimal ris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king Looptor 20 Tablet might reduce alertness, impair vision, and cause drowsiness or d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Looptor 20 Tablet can be used by individuals with kidney disease without altering the dosage. Nevertheless, disclose any kidney condition to your physician. Use of Looptor 20 Tablet should be avoided if urination is impaired or if the kidney impairment stems from other medications.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use Looptor 20 Tablets cautiously, as dose mod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Looptor 20 Tablet :
Should you forget a Looptor 20 Tablet dose,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is nearly due,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ing pattern. Avoid taking a double dose.
